Real Madrid Confirm Dani Carvajal Exit as Mourinho Hired
Real Madrid announced that Dani Carvajal will leave the club when his contract expires at the end of the season. The club also confirmed that Jose Mourinho has been appointed as the new manager.
Carvajal has spent 13 seasons as a first‑team regular, contributing to the team's successes over more than a decade. His tenure includes numerous domestic and European titles.
For several weeks, it was widely assumed that Carvajal would depart, and the club’s statement confirmed those expectations. The announcement removes any doubt about his future with the club.
Mourinho’s agreement with Real Madrid was confirmed on the same day as Carvajal’s departure notice. The Portuguese coach will take charge ahead of the upcoming campaign.
Carvajal’s contract runs until the close of the current campaign, and the club has chosen not to extend it. No renewal option was exercised.
No further details regarding Carvajal’s next destination have been released by the club. The statement focused solely on the contract expiration.
Real Madrid will now plan its defensive options for the next season without Carvajal. The club’s preparations will continue under Mourinho’s leadership.
